Discuss some design considerations that you should keep in mind when you want to design a professional-looking flyer or newslett
Korvikt [17]

A designer should always balance the placement of text and graphics and create room for every element to breathe. When this is followed, the flyer template will create a feeling of balance and calm.


Consider adding a border: Borders can help your flyer or newsletter stand out wherever it is placed. Selection of certain colors, Italics and ALL CAPS can draw attention to particular points in a text.


Boost contrast with style, color and font size: Always use font weight to differentiate sections of text. Many fonts offer regular, bold and light options for font weight.


Align text for a balanced look: A designer should consider using a grid system that contains intersecting vertical and horizontal lines that are often based on optimal proportions for the document’s size. Aligning text in the center will give a pleasant symmetrical look.

Select the correct answer from each drop-down menu. Which IF formulas are valid? _____ and _____ are valid IF formulas.
Lyrx [107]

Answer:

=IF(D3>50; E3; F3) AND =IF(A1>60;"Pass";"Fail")

Explanation:

An IF structure is built following this pattern:

IF(TEST;IFTRUE;IFFALSE)

These are the only options in the given drop-down menus what comply with this pattern.  All others are not following this pattern.

The computer will do the test and if the result is true will apply the IFTRUE value, otherwise will apply the IFFALSE value.
